a detailed plan for achieving success
"Strong teamwork is the blueprint for success in this project."
to act in a manipulative or strategic way to gain advantage
to have a part in something
to change one's opinion or attitude
to shout and complain loudly
behind the surface; the underlying mechanism or system
a virtual representation of a physical object or system used...